Transaction 08659961a10b9a417d718c6da43931bd718924f79d863a1df7e62e917c967a04

1 Input
2 Outputs
  • 08659961a10b9a417d718c6da43931bd718924f79d863a1df7e62e917c967a04:0
  • value  513691
    address  bc1qvrq2cq8fpun3z4j88cgd7jlfhgvfz8dzxverlx
  • 08659961a10b9a417d718c6da43931bd718924f79d863a1df7e62e917c967a04:1
  • value  743296
    address  3HEhm8XzkwprgwyFQEfmBZS6XysRd5gZAs